The Basic Principles of Krav Maga: Mastering Self-Defense Explained

"Krav Maga" has increasingly gained prominence in the world of self-defense and martial arts.


When broaching the topic, "What are the basic principles of Krav Maga?" it's crucial to delve into its core tenets that make it a distinctive and practical combat system. Developed in the mid-20th century by Imi Lichtenfeld for the Israeli military, Krav Maga operates on a set of fundamental principles that prioritize real-world functionality and efficiency. 


Outlined in this article are the five cornerstone principles that define Krav Maga, providing a comprehensive resource for blogs, journalists, and those interested in this unique martial art.


1. Neutralization of Threats


Above all, Krav Maga prioritizes the swift neutralization of threats. Its techniques are formulated to rapidly and efficiently incapacitate an assailant, emphasizing vital target areas like the eyes, throat, and groin. This principle is foundational because, in real-world situations, time is often of the essence.


2. Simultaneous Defense and Attack


One of the distinguishing aspects of Krav Maga is its emphasis on simultaneous defense and offense. Instead of blocking an attack and then retaliating, practitioners are trained to defend and strike concurrently. This reduces the time an attacker has to react and increases the defender's chances of gaining the upper hand.


3. Retzev - Continuous Motion


The Hebrew term "Retzev" encapsulates the idea of fluid, relentless, and continuous motion in Krav Maga. Practitioners are taught to chain together defensive and offensive maneuvers, ensuring that the opponent is given little to no opportunity to regain composure or retaliate.


4. Practicality and Adaptability


Krav Maga does not involve complex sequences or choreographed kata. Instead, it emphasizes instinctual, straightforward techniques that can be applied in varied and unpredictable real-life scenarios. This principle ensures that a practitioner can adapt and respond, whether facing an armed or unarmed attacker, multiple assailants, or diverse environments.


5. Focus on Scenario Training


To ensure real-world applicability, Krav Maga training heavily incorporates scenario-based drills. This includes simulating common assault situations, varying environmental factors, and even training in low-light conditions. Such training cultivates a practitioner's ability to remain calm, think clearly, and act decisively under pressure.




Krav Maga, with its roots in the battlefields and streets, is distinguished by its unwavering commitment to practicality and efficiency. Through its five basic principles - neutralization, simultaneous defense and offense, continuous motion, adaptability, and scenario training - this martial system empowers its practitioners with the skills and mindset required to tackle real-world threats.
